The Rise of the New Machines: Aerodynamic Revolution

The 2017 Formula 1 season heralded a new era with revolutionary aerodynamic regulations. These changes were the most significant in years, designed to dramatically increase downforce and create cars that were visually stunning. Gone were the sleek, narrow cars of previous seasons; in their place were machines with wider bodies, larger wings, and more aggressive designs. The impact of these changes was immediately apparent: the cars were significantly faster, breaking lap records at almost every circuit. But it wasn't just about speed; these new regulations also reshaped how teams approached car design and race strategy. The increased downforce put a greater emphasis on aerodynamics, forcing engineers to find innovative ways to manage airflow and maximize grip. The wider tires, which were also introduced, further enhanced the cars' performance, allowing them to take corners at higher speeds. Key Drivers and Their Performances

The 2017 season saw some incredible performances from individual drivers, each with their own stories of success and challenges. Lewis Hamilton, driving for Mercedes, delivered a masterclass, displaying both speed and consistency. His championship victory was a result of his incredible driving skills and the strong support from his team. Hamilton's rivals saw the season as a true display of his talent and determination. Sebastian Vettel, driving for Ferrari, showed his resilience. Despite challenges, he consistently challenged Hamilton, proving his worth as a top driver. Vettel's battles with Hamilton were the highlights of the season, showcasing their exceptional talent and the rivalry between Ferrari and Mercedes. Valtteri Bottas, in his first season with Mercedes, also played a crucial role. Bottas proved to be a reliable teammate, scoring key points for the team and contributing to their overall success. Bottas showcased that he could perform at a high level under pressure. Daniel Ricciardo from Red Bull was renowned for his aggressive driving and ability to make exciting overtakes. Ricciardo's performances were exciting for fans and proved that he was a top-tier driver. Ricciardo made a significant contribution to Red Bull's points total, demonstrating his talent.

Memorable Races and Standout Moments

The 2017 Formula 1 season was filled with moments that stand out in the minds of fans. Some races were filled with drama. The Azerbaijan Grand Prix was an unforgettable event that featured multiple safety car periods. The race delivered a mix of chaos and excitement, including a dramatic collision between Vettel and Hamilton. It was a race that had everything, showcasing the unpredictable nature of Formula 1. The Italian Grand Prix at Monza was another highlight, with Ferrari and Mercedes battling at their home tracks. The battle between the two teams was intense, demonstrating their rivalry. The race resulted in a Ferrari victory. The Singapore Grand Prix, run under challenging conditions, had a chaotic start.
